Kanyo's flirtatious thoughts

Clive 2003 (Limpopo)



Come near. Dear friend
Allow me to rest in your mystique
Carry me into the distant land
Let me into you
Let me fall!
I want you.

How can you not tell that I need you?
I have shown all the signs that
I need you
dear
When will you hold me?
Do you notice my silent pain?
The least you can do is give me some attention.
I’m in grave need for your attention.
Someone please save me from this!

I can’t make the first move to you
You know very well that you are forbidden
Everyone hates you
Everyone fears you
Yet you entertain them more than me but
I am the only one willing to welcome you
You are so unpredictable
What are you made of?
You truly are fearsome
But I am falling in love with danger,
Or whatever fits to describe you.
I need you near
With all humility, take me away.

‘Hugs, kisses and tears.’

About this poem

The poem is from a from the Wattpad story 'A Stranger’s Love' by Clive. The main character of the story cries her need for something. Kanyo, the main character, looks at whatever that she wants as a medium for relief. The poem serves as an opener for the story as an attempt to provoke the thoughts of readers.
